Bramlett's Grizzly Bear will no longer be at public stud after March of 2003. Stud fee is $125 cash. If you would like to breed to him please make arrangements this winter. Bear is AKC/ARHA registered. He has an extremely loud bawl mouth that a high % of his pups get. He is on the high end of medium speed and runs close to the line. Close on checks and handles as good as anything I have ever hunted with. No trash ever. I am in the process of AKC DNA profiling him. His pedigree can be viewed at
http://www.blackdirtbeagles.homestead.com and then click on Bear's link. I have never trialed him, but he has placed in ARHA LP hunts in 4 different states with his previous owner(i've owned him 6 years now). Only lacks a 1st to finish but i rarely trial.
